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ma attorneys specialize in asbestos litigation, which includes lawsuits and claims against trust funds. They must be knowledgeable of state laws and national legal requirements to successfully process these types of claims.

They should also have access to asbestos databases of asbestos-contaminated sites and identify asbestos claim-related companies that could be responsible for the exposure. The right asbestos lawyer can make the lawsuit process easier, so that victims can focus on their treatment and stay with their families.

The first step in filing an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ney for a free case evaluation. Your lawyer will assist you to decide on the best claim for your situation and which companies are liable. Asbestos exposure can take many forms which makes it difficult for victims of asbestos to pinpoint the exact date or location they were exposed. However, mesothelioma attorneys have access to databases that list thousands of businesses, products, and job places where asbestos exposure has occurred.

Asbestos attorneys are also aware of how they can analyze a case to find evidence to prove your claim. For instance, you may have medical records that prove your mesothelioma diagnosis or a death certificate that lists "mesothelioma" as the cause of your death of a loved one. Asbestos lawyers are familiar with how to request these documents and what questions to ask to get the most value out of them.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is skilled will also be aware of how state laws affect the way you make your claim. For instance the law in New York requires that you file your lawsuit in-state if the company responsible for your asbestos exposure is from the state. Attorneys with national firms will have experience filing claims in different states and know the laws in each state.

Mesothelioma is a potentially fatal and painful disease is a condition that affects the linings and linings of the lungs. It is caused by exposure to asbestos which was used in a variety of commercial and residential construction materials for more than 30 years. The exposure may occur in a variety of different ways, including at work or in schools, as well as in the military, and at home.

If a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ma they may bring a personal injury lawsuit against the company responsible for their exposure to asbestos. They can also file a wrongful-death claim on behalf of a loved one who passed away due to mesothelioma, or other asbestos law-related illnesses.

Asbestos sufferers can claim financial compensation for expenses like lost wages, medical bills and the costs of treatment. Asbestos lawyers can assist their clients collect damages by filing mesothelioma suits or trust fund claims against companies that are responsible for asbestos exposure. They can also assist clients in filing a w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f a loved one who has passed away from m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can determine whether a patient has a valid claim for compensation and assist them in filing a lawsuit, trust fund or VA claim. Each mesothelioma lawsuit is unique and determined by a number of factors, such as the victim's asbestos-exposure, their age at the time of diagnosis, and the amount of money they've lost due to the disease. Compensation could include past and future medical expenses and lost wages, as well as the loss of a loved one legal fees as well as punitive damages, suffering and pain.
